What is your basic skincare routine?
In the morning, I rinse with cool water and moisturize. I used to use a gentle cleanser in my morning routine, but I’ve learned that as long as you go to bed with a clean face, the oils that build up overnight are actually really healthy for your skin! I might recommend using a cleanser though if your skin type is oily.

At night, I deep clean with my Clarisonic and a cleanserthen moisturize. I should be using an eye cream, but I feel so overwhelmed with the abundance of choices out there! Any recommendations?

What is your everyday makeup look?
I’ve got my work-week makeup routine down to a science! After cleansing and moisturizing, I apply a small amount of primer to my face. I follow this with foundation mixed with an illuminizer and some under-eye concealer, all blended with a beautyblender. I use setting spray and since I use a liquid foundation/illuminizer combo, I usually take a quick break to let it dry and style my hair or pick out my outfit for the day. Anastasia Beverly Hills Brow Wiz is a life-saver when it comes to filling in the sections of my brows that just don’t want to grow in. Next, I dust on some bronzer and blush, then finish with a liquid liner cat-eye, mascara (when I’m in between eyelash extensions) and a neutral lip.

What is your best hair trick?
Brushing the conditioner out of my hair in-shower. For all of you who struggle with knotty hair and haven’t tried this, your life is about to change! Not only does this help to disperse the conditioner evenly throughout your hair, but it saves so much detangling time once you’re out of the shower.
